s3c-hsudc: Add basic otg transceiver handling

Makes it possible to use i.e. gpio-vbus to handle vbus events.

@@ -1171,6 +1173,22 @@ static int s3c_hsudc_start(struct usb_gadget_driver *driver,
 		return ret;
 	}
 
+	/* connect to bus through transceiver */
+	if (hsudc->transceiver) {
+		ret = otg_set_peripheral(hsudc->transceiver, &hsudc->gadget);
+		if (ret) {
+			dev_err(hsudc->dev, "%s: can't bind to transceiver\n",
+					hsudc->gadget.name);
+			driver->unbind(&hsudc->gadget);
+
+			device_del(&hsudc->gadget.dev);
+
+			hsudc->driver = NULL;
+			hsudc->gadget.dev.driver = NULL;
+			return ret;
+		}
+	}
+
 	enable_irq(hsudc->irq);
 	dev_info(hsudc->dev, "bound driver %s\n", driver->driver.name);
